  By: Turner of Tarrant (Senate Sponsor - West) H.B. No. 1222
         (In the Senate - Received from the House April 15, 2013;
  April 17, 2013, read first time and referred to Committee on
  Jurisprudence; May 9, 2013, reported favorably by the following
  vote:  Yeas 6, Nays 0; May 9, 2013, sent to printer.)
 
 
A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
 
AN ACT
 
  relating to venue for certain alleged violations or offenses under
  the Water Safety Act.
         B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
         SECTION 1.  Section 31.126(a), Parks and Wildlife Code, is
  amended to read as follows:
         (a)  Venue for an alleged violation or offense under the
  provisions of this chapter is in the justice court, [or] county
  court, or municipal court having jurisdiction where the violation
  or offense was committed.
         SECTION 2.  Section 31.126(a), Parks and Wildlife Code, as
  amended by this Act, applies only to a violation that occurs or an
  offense that is committed on or after the effective date of this
  Act. A violation that occurs or an offense that is committed before
  the effective date of this Act is governed by the law in effect when
  the violation occurred or the offense was committed, and the former
  law is continued in effect for that purpose. For purposes of this
  section, a violation occurs or an offense is committed before the
  effective date of this Act if any element of the violation or
  offense occurs or is committed before that date.
         SECTION 3.  This Act takes effect immediately if it receives
  a vote of two-thirds of all the members elected to each house, as
  provided by Section 39, Article III, Texas Constitution.  If this
  Act does not receive the vote necessary for immediate effect, this
  Act takes effect September 1, 2013.
